What is Prodi Ekonomi Pembangunan UNSIL?
Alright, let's start with the basics. Prodi Ekonomi Pembangunan UNSIL, which translates to the Development Economics Study Program at UNSIL, is essentially a program designed to give you a deep understanding of how economies develop, particularly in developing countries. It's a field that combines economic theory with practical applications, focusing on issues like poverty, inequality, economic growth, and sustainable development. Think of it as a journey into the heart of how nations can improve their economic well-being and the quality of life for their citizens. The program at UNSIL offers a comprehensive curriculum that equips students with the knowledge and skills needed to analyze economic problems, formulate effective policies, and contribute to positive change. You'll learn how to use economic tools and models to understand the complexities of development, and how to apply those tools to real-world challenges. The Curriculum and Courses
Now, let's talk about what you'll actually be studying. The curriculum for the Prodi Ekonomi Pembangunan UNSIL is designed to provide a solid foundation in economic theory, quantitative methods, and development economics. You'll take core courses that cover microeconomics, macroeconomics, econometrics, and public finance. These courses are the building blocks of your understanding, providing you with the essential tools and frameworks you'll need to analyze economic issues. But it doesn't stop there. You'll also delve into specialized courses that focus on development-related topics, such as poverty and inequality, economic growth, international trade, and environmental economics. These courses allow you to explore the specific challenges and opportunities that developing countries face. Career Opportunities
So, what can you actually do with a degree in Prodi Ekonomi Pembangunan UNSIL? Good question! The job market for development economists is diverse and offers a wide range of exciting opportunities. Graduates of this program are well-prepared for careers in government, international organizations, non-governmental organizations (NGOs), and the private sector. Let's break down some potential career paths. You might find yourself working as an economist in a government ministry, advising on economic policy, analyzing data, and helping to shape the future of your country's economy. Imagine the impact you could have! Many graduates also go on to work for international organizations like the World Bank, the International Monetary Fund (IMF), or the United Nations. In these roles, you'd be involved in projects aimed at promoting economic development and reducing poverty in developing countries. Or, you could join an NGO, working on projects related to sustainable development, poverty alleviation, or environmental conservation. NGOs play a crucial role in addressing social and economic challenges, and your skills would be highly valued. The private sector also offers a range of opportunities. Consulting firms often hire development economists to provide expertise on economic issues. You could also work in research, conducting studies on economic trends and policy impacts. Admission and Requirements
Okay, so you're interested in joining the Prodi Ekonomi Pembangunan UNSIL? Awesome! Here's what you need to know about the admission process and requirements. First of all, the specific requirements may vary slightly from year to year, so it's always a good idea to check the latest information on the official UNSIL website or contact the admissions office directly. Generally, you'll need to have a high school diploma or equivalent. The application process typically involves submitting an application form, along with supporting documents such as transcripts, a copy of your identity card (KTP), and passport-sized photographs. Some programs may also require you to take an entrance exam, which assesses your knowledge of economics, mathematics, and English. The entrance exam is designed to evaluate your readiness for the program and ensure you have the necessary foundational knowledge. It's also a good idea to start preparing for the entrance exam well in advance. Study the relevant subjects, practice sample questions, and familiarize yourself with the exam format. Once your application has been processed, you may be invited for an interview. The interview is an opportunity for the admissions committee to get to know you better, assess your motivations, and evaluate your suitability for the program. Be prepared to answer questions about your academic background, your interest in development economics, and your career aspirations.
